Student Health Technician

Location : Washington, DC

We're currently seeking a Student Health Technician to carry out designated responsibilities under the guidance of a registered nurse or licensed practical nurse. As an integral part of the healthcare team, you'll contribute to various student services following the initial assessment and development of nursing care plans by the registered nurse. Your duties may encompass screening procedures like height and weight measurements, as well as vision and hearing tests. Additionally, you'll be responsible for obtaining, recording, and monitoring vital signs, promptly reporting any deviations from the norm to the relevant personnel. This role involves rotation between assigned DCPS schools.
